- MOHAN PRASATH S ECEJan 09, 2025 · a year agoSure, technical analysis is a popular method used by traders to predict future price movements based on historical data. To get started, you can begin by learning about different technical indicators such as moving averages, MACD, RSI, and Bollinger Bands. These indicators can help you identify trends, momentum, and potential reversal points in the market. Additionally, it's important to understand support and resistance levels, as they can act as key areas where price may bounce or break through. Keep in mind that technical analysis is not foolproof and should be used in conjunction with other forms of analysis and risk management strategies.
